What is Women's Health Physiotherapy

The Specialist Care Indian Women Are Routinely Missing

Women's health physiotherapy is a deeply under-served area in India. Issues like postnatal pelvic floor weakness, diastasis recti and pregnancy back pain are frequently dismissed as 'normal' — but they're highly treatable.

Our female-led team has trained specifically in pregnancy, postnatal, pelvic floor and menopause care. We use evidence-based protocols from the UK, US and Australian women's-health communities — adapted for Indian patients.

All women's-health sessions are conducted by a female physiotherapist in a private treatment room. Confidentiality, comfort and respect are non-negotiable.

Warning Signs

Signs You'd Benefit from Women's Health Physio

If any of these feel familiar — they're highly treatable, not 'just part of being a woman'.

💧

Any leaking, ever

Even occasional leaks on coughing or laughing aren't 'normal'.

Feeling of heaviness

Pelvic 'dragging' or pressure — common in prolapse.

🤰

Pregnancy pain

Lower back, hip, pelvic girdle or pubic-bone pain.

👶

Postnatal weakness

Lower back pain, doming belly, can't return to running.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common Questions Answered

Quick answers to questions our Juhu patients ask most often.

Will the physiotherapist be female?
Yes — all women's-health sessions are conducted by our female women's-health-trained physiotherapist.
Will I need an internal examination?
Only if appropriate AND you consent. Many issues can be assessed and treated externally. You remain in complete control.
Can I do this during pregnancy?
Yes — women's health physio is fully safe in pregnancy when delivered by a trained physiotherapist.
How soon can I start postnatal physio?
Usually 6 weeks post-delivery (vaginal or C-section), after obstetrician clearance.
Does pelvic floor physio really work?
Yes — evidence is overwhelming for stress incontinence, urge incontinence, prolapse and pelvic pain.
Do you offer home visits during pregnancy or postnatal?
Yes — particularly useful in third trimester and the first weeks postnatal.
